Abstract

The utility model discloses a kind of compound dismountable type step riveting nut, it includes riveting tube body, the head end of described riveting tube body is provided with outward extending shade body, and offer big stepped hole in described riveting tube body, wherein, the bottom of described big stepped hole offers screwed hole, and described riveting tube body is arranged with the liner collar selected according to the big freedom in minor affairs dismounting being riveted the pre-hole of workpiece.Above-mentioned compound dismountable type step riveting nut has good riveting effect as can making between the riveting workpiece in riveting nut and different-thickness, pre-hole, more common riveting nut has the most superior mechanical properties strength, the most only need to unload the riveting nut use that the dismountable type liner collar can become general.Improve riveting nut to being riveted the thickness range that workpiece is suitable for, save client cost.

Description

A kind of compound dismountable type step riveting nut
Technical field
This utility model relates to a kind of riveting nut, especially relates to a kind of compound dismountable type step riveting nut.
Background technology
At present, riveting nut has been widely used for metal, nonmetallic plane, the riveting of non-planar junction component.With one As riveting class securing member compare, riveting nut riveting after wherein another structure can freely dismantle, combine rivet and nut Function, it is simple to keep in repair and update.Therefore in electronics industry, shipbuilding industry, automobile, motor-car manufacture also and aviation field etc. the most Start extensively to use.
But, when existing riveting nut rivets for multiple riveting workpiece in different pre-holes, often by riveting bar The restriction of part and occur riveting bad situation.
Utility model content
The purpose of this utility model is to provide one compound dismountable type step riveting nut, its can make riveting nut with Different-thickness, riveting of pre-hole have good riveting effect equally between workpiece, and have more superior mechanical properties strength, with Solve the problems referred to above existed when riveting nut in prior art rivets for multiple riveting workpiece in different pre-holes.
For reaching this purpose, this utility model by the following technical solutions:
One is combined dismountable type step riveting nut, and it includes riveting tube body, and the head end of described riveting tube body arranges oriented Offering big stepped hole in the shade body of outer extension, and described riveting tube body, wherein, the bottom of described big stepped hole offers spiral shell Pit, described riveting tube body is arranged with the liner collar selected according to the big freedom in minor affairs dismounting being riveted the pre-hole of workpiece.
Especially, the lateral wall of the described liner collar offers embedded anti-slop serrations.
Especially, the tail end of described riveting tube body is provided with the guide section that cross-sectional area tapers into.
Especially, the external diameter of riveting tube body described in the inner hole of the described liner collar is arranged.
The beneficial effects of the utility model are, the most described compound dismountable type step riveting nut is at riveting pipe It is provided with the liner collar that can freely dismantle selection on body, under the conditions of solving different-thickness and pre-bore dia, rivets workpiece Between riveting in occur unfavorable condition, compensate for common riveting nut to being riveted thickness of workpiece scope and the harshness of pre-hole size Requirement;For the high rivet performance requirement under the conditions of the multiple pre-bore dia occurred between multiple riveting workpiece, also can produce very well Effect.Riveting environment under the conditions of i.e. using a riveting nut just can solve different-thickness and multiple pre-bore dia, improves Riveting nut, to being riveted the scope of application of workpiece, has saved client cost.The periphery of this liner collar is provided with embedding Enter after formula anti-slop serrations has stopped product riveting and be riveted the possibility that on workpiece, skidding rotation phenomenon occurs, enhance riveting nut And the combination effect being riveted between workpiece, is greatly improved the driving torque of riveting nut, it is therefore prevented that product is on riveting workpiece The defect that easily skidding rotates, makes product shear behavior between riveting workpiece improve 3 times simultaneously, and this riveting nut exists The riveting nut use that the dismountable type liner collar can become general only need to be unloaded under the conditions of common riveting.

Detailed description of the invention
Further illustrate the technical solution of the utility model below in conjunction with the accompanying drawings and by detailed description of the invention.
Referring to shown in Fig. 1 to Fig. 4, in the present embodiment, a kind of compound dismountable type step riveting nut includes riveting tube body 1, the head end of described riveting tube body 1 offers big stepped hole in being provided with outward extending shade body 2, and described riveting tube body 1 3, the bottom of described big stepped hole 3 offers screwed hole 4, described riveting tube body 1 is arranged with according to being riveted the pre-hole of workpiece Big freedom in minor affairs dismantles the liner collar 5 selected, and described in the inner hole of the described liner collar 5, the external diameter of riveting tube body 1 is arranged, institute Stating the liner collar 4 height, to be riveted workpiece 6 with big pre-hole consistent, the lateral wall of the described liner collar 5 offers and embedded prevents Slip teeth 7.
Be riveted workpiece 6 for big pre-hole and little pre-hole be riveted workpiece 8 rivet time, the liner collar 5 is filled out automatically Fill big pre-hole and be riveted the gap size between workpiece 6 and riveting nut, the riveting workpiece 8 then riveting normal with riveting nut of little pre-hole Connect, the deformation automatically generated by big stepped hole 3, according to on-the-spot riveting condition automatic moulding bulge 9, the size of bulge 9 by Big pre-hole is riveted workpiece 6 and little pre-hole is riveted workpiece 8 total thickness and determines.
The tail end of described riveting tube body 1 is provided with the guide section 10 that cross-sectional area tapers into, and makes riveting by guide section 10 Connected nut more easily pass be provided with pre-hole be riveted workpiece.
When to be riveted workpiece rivet time, the rifle head on clincher tool pass shade body 2, riveting tube body 1, big step Install with the screw thread in screwed hole 4 behind hole 3 and screw, inserted by the guide section 10 in outside the most together and be riveted on workpiece in advance In the riveted holes held successfully, then it is pulled outwardly.Riveting tube body 1 upper end is made to be forced into bird-caging bulge portion outward expansion, until at quilt Form bird-caging bulge 9 inside riveting piece, make to be riveted piece-holder at this bird-caging bulge 9 and the shade as spacing plane Between body 2.
Now when being riveted on workpiece the different grip of appearance and riveting pre-bore dia, the riveting that riveting condition is more complicated During T-Ring border, then common riveting nut cannot normally work;And the liner collar 5 of this riveting nut is i.e. for this feelings Condition, completes efficiently to rivet.Under above-mentioned case conditions to be riveted workpiece rivet time, need to be at the outer sheath of riveting tube body 1 The upper liner collar 5 is also pushed into the root of shade body 2, and the rifle head on clincher tool passes shade body 2, riveting tube body 1, big platform Install with the screw thread in screwed hole 4 behind hole, rank 3 and screw, insert big pre-hole by the guide section 10 in outside the most together and be riveted work In part 6, the height of the liner collar 5 is riveted the highly consistent of workpiece 6 with big pre-hole.Insert little by guide section 10 the most together Pre-hole is riveted workpiece 8, is finally pulled outwardly, and makes riveting tube body 1 upper end be forced into bird-caging bulge outward expansion, until at quilt Form bird-caging bulge 9 inside riveting piece, make to be riveted piece-holder at this bird-caging bulge 9 and the shade as spacing plane Between body 2.
